1. Claim your Google Business Profile

Your Google Business Profile is the single most important marketing asset for a local electrician. When someone searches “electrician near me”, Google shows the local map pack first — and that's powered by Google Business Profiles. Claim yours, add photos of your work, respond to reviews, and keep your hours up to date.

3. Build a simple website

Your website doesn't need to be fancy. It needs to clearly state: what services you offer, what areas you cover, your licence number, and how to contact you. Add a few photos of your work and some customer reviews. A one-page website is better than no website.

4. Ask for reviews

After every job, ask the customer to leave a Google review. Send them a direct link to your Google review page (you can create this from your Google Business dashboard). Reviews are the number one factor in local search rankings after proximity.
